Saratoga Springs, N.Y. – The Skidmore College men's soccer team suffered a tough 1-0 loss to 18
th-ranked Hobart in Friday afternoon's Liberty League matchup at Wachenheim Field.
The Thoroughbreds fall to 4-6 overall and 1-2 in league play, while the Statesmen improve to 8-1 overall and 1-1 league.
Caetano Sanchez scored the lone goal of the contest, putting his team up in the 72
nd minute. Sanchez headed a ball put on goal by Taylor Jones past Skidmore keeper
Nick Peterson for his first goal of the season.
A few minutes later, the Thoroughbreds tried to answer on a shot from
Diego Reinero that was swatted away by Hobart goalie Charlie Hale, forcing a corner. On the corner,
Andrew Blake corralled a loose ball and sent it on goal, but a defender was able to clear it before it crossed the goal line. Skidmore was able to get a few more shots off but couldn't put one on goal as the Statesmen held on for the 1-0 win.
Peterson finished with three saves, while Hale made two.
The Thoroughbreds outshot Hobart, 9-8 but the Statesmen held a 9-7 advantage in penalty corners.
Skidmore host RIT at 2 p.m. tomorrow, while Hobart is at Union.
